#6defe5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6defe5 is composed of 42.7% red, 93.7%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.2%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 175.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 68.2%. #6defe5 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#00dfcb.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#6defe5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d0c is the darkest color, while #fafef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6defe5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abb1b0 is the less saturated color, while #61fbf0 is the most saturated one.
